Safety First
Why Outdated Switchboards Are a Real Danger
An old switchboard is one of the leading causes of electrical fires in Australian homes. The key dangers include:
- No RCD protection
- Without safety switches, a fault in any appliance or wiring can send lethal current through a person's body for seconds or longer. RCDs cut power in 30 milliseconds, fast enough to prevent fatal electrocution in most scenarios. The absence of RCDs is the single biggest safety issue we see in older <a href="/locations/murray-bridge/">Murray Bridge</a> homes.
- Asbestos backing boards
- Switchboards manufactured before the mid-1980s commonly used asbestos cement backing panels. These are safe when undisturbed, but any work on the board, or deterioration over time, can release fibres. A switchboard upgrade replaces the entire enclosure with a modern, safe unit.
- Corroded connections
- After 30-40 years, bus bars and terminal connections corrode. Corrosion increases resistance, which generates heat, which accelerates corrosion. It is a dangerous feedback loop that can lead to arcing and fire.
- Inadequate capacity
- A 1970s home might have had a 40-amp main switch and six circuits. Today's homes routinely need 63-80 amps across 16-24 circuits. Running modern loads through undersized wiring and overloaded circuits creates persistent overheating.
Regulations
SA Switchboard Standards and Requirements
South Australian electrical regulations (based on AS/NZS 3000, the Wiring Rules) set clear standards for switchboard safety. Here is what applies:
- All new installations and major alterations must include RCDs (safety switches) on all final sub-circuits, both power and lighting
- Circuit breakers must replace rewirable fuses on any circuit that is modified or extended
- Switchboards must be accessible, with a minimum clearance of 600mm in front and adequate ventilation
- A main switch capable of disconnecting all active conductors must be fitted
- Switchboard enclosures must meet current IP (ingress protection) ratings for their installed location, indoor or outdoor
- When solar is installed, the switchboard must accommodate the solar supply main switch, and existing protection must meet current standards
In practice, this means that adding solar panels, installing a new battery system, or wiring a new air conditioning circuit to an old switchboard often triggers a requirement to bring the entire board up to current standards. It is better to do this proactively than be forced into it during another project.
The Process
What Does a Switchboard Upgrade Involve?
A switchboard upgrade is typically a one-day job for a licensed electrician. Here is what the process looks like:
Assessment and Quote
We inspect your existing switchboard, assess the number of circuits needed, check your incoming supply capacity with SA Power Networks, and provide a fixed-price quote. If asbestos is present, we arrange licensed removal.
Power Disconnection
On the day of the upgrade, we coordinate a temporary power disconnection with SA Power Networks. For most residential jobs, power is off for 4-6 hours. We schedule this to minimise disruption.
Removal and Installation
The old switchboard is removed and the new enclosure is mounted. All circuits are transferred to new circuit breakers, RCDs are installed on all circuits, and the wiring is tested and labelled. We install a board with spare capacity for future additions.
Testing and Certification
Every circuit is tested for insulation resistance, earth continuity, polarity, and RCD trip time. You receive a Certificate of Compliance (COC) and we lodge the paperwork with the Office of the Technical Regulator (OTR) as required.
Investment
What Decides the Cost of a Switchboard Upgrade
No two switchboards are the same, so a published price range tells you very little about what your own board will cost. What it does tell you is that the spread is wide, and that a quote given over the phone before anyone has opened the board is a guess. These are the things that actually move the number.
| What Drives the Cost | Why It Changes the Job |
|---|---|
| Number of circuits | Every circuit needs its own breaker and its own RCD protection, and each one has to be identified, transferred and tested. A board with twenty circuits is a longer job than one with eight. |
| Asbestos in the old board | Older enclosures and backing boards can contain asbestos. If they do, removal is licensed work with its own procedure and its own cost, and it has to happen before the new board goes on. |
| Condition of the existing wiring | If the wiring coming into the board is brittle, undersized or has been extended over the years, that has to be made good rather than reconnected as found. |
| Whether the supply changes | Going from single-phase to three-phase means an SA Power Networks application, a new supply cable and a different board. That is a much bigger job than a board swap. |
| Enclosure size and spare capacity | Fitting a board with room for a future solar system, EV charger or air conditioner costs a little more now and saves a second upgrade later. |
| Meter and metering position | If the meter has to be moved or replaced, your retailer and the metering provider get involved, and that is scheduled separately from our work. |
Reading a Quote
What a Proper Switchboard Quote Should Itemise
- The board itself: make, number of poles, and how many spare ways are left when the job is finished
- RCD protection listed circuit by circuit, not as a single line item
- Whether asbestos testing and removal is included, excluded, or provisional
- Any make-good on incoming or existing wiring found to be unserviceable
- Testing, labelling and the Certificate of Compliance, which are not optional extras
- Whether an SA Power Networks application or a metering change is part of the price or additional

FAQ
Switchboard Upgrade Questions Answered
How long does a switchboard upgrade take?
Most residential switchboard upgrades are completed in a single day: typically 4 to 6 hours of work, plus the time for SA Power Networks to disconnect and reconnect supply. We schedule the work to minimise time without power and will let you know the expected timeline before we start.

Does my switchboard have asbestos?
If your switchboard was installed before the mid-1980s, there is a reasonable chance the backing board contains asbestos cement. We can identify this during our assessment. If asbestos is present, a licensed asbestos removalist handles the backing board before we install the new switchboard. This adds to the cost but is non-negotiable for safety.
Can I just add safety switches to my old switchboard?
Sometimes, yes. If the existing board has space and is in reasonable condition, adding RCDs without a full upgrade can be a cost-effective safety improvement. However, if the board uses ceramic fuses, has corroded components, or lacks circuit breakers, retrofitting RCDs alone is not sufficient and a full upgrade is recommended. We can assess which approach is right for your situation.
Do I need council approval for a switchboard upgrade?
No council approval or building permit is needed for a like-for-like switchboard replacement. However, the work must be carried out by a licensed electrician and a Certificate of Compliance (COC) is lodged with the SA Office of the Technical Regulator. If the upgrade involves a supply increase (e.g., single to three-phase), SA Power Networks approval is required, and we handle this application on your behalf.
